I want to set up, if possible, some function keys or shortcuts with some names of characters for something I am writing. Is it possible to do this in word and does anybody know how to do it?

You'll have to record a macro, and assign it to a key.

To do this, go to Tools, Macros, Record New Macro. Click on the keyboard, and assign it to a key. Press the function key, then click Assign and Close.

Now, type the name you wish to assign (maybe with a space afterward). Stop recording by pressing the stop button on the recording toolbar.

Now, every time you press the key you programmed, it will type the name you wish.

I created a sample. If you look into the visual basic editor, you should have a macro that looks like this:

Sub type_Roger()
'
' type_Roger Macro
' Macro recorded 1/6/2007 by CuriousC
'
Selection.TypeText Text:="Roger "
End Sub

This macro types the name Roger every time I press a function key.
